THIS IS A NO RESERVE AUCTION!!!! One of a Kind 1983 Honda CB1000 Custom that is great condition. This is a very unique motorcycle that was manufactured for one year only!! This motorcycle was considered Honda's top of the line sport touring bike in 1983 and featured a 10 Speed Dual Range Transmission and a Air Ride suspension. This is your chance to own a piece of Honda motorcycling history at a very reasonable price. All paint, chrome and other finishes are in 100% original condition. The gas tank and side cover paint is in great shape and the chrome is still shiny with just a few worn spots. The seat has no tears or scuffs and except for a stone ding on the left side of the gas tank and a small dent in the left crash bar, the bike has no major cosmetic issues. This bike would make a great everyday rider as is or if you prefer, It would take very little to restore it to museum quality. The engine runs and revs without a miss and is very smooth with absolutely no exhaust smoke. The oil and filter were just changed, it has a new air filter and battery and the front fork seals were just replaced. The tires have plenty of tread left. The only engine issue is that the starter bendix will sometimes not engage the first time the starter button is pressed and when the engine is idling, you can hear the bendix rattling a little bit. It's very easy to change the starter on this model and if you decide to replace it, you can use the Clymer Service Manual that comes with the bike. The bike also includes the original tool kit and air pressure guage to adjust the Air Ride Suspension, a factory Sissy Bar and a Luggage Rack.
